Bazan Meaning

  • A Companion of Prophet (PBUH)
  • Origin - Arabic

The name Bazan is of Arabic origin and means A Companion of Prophet (PBUH). It is often used as a Male name and is mostly used as a Last Name.

Bazan is commonly found in United States of America, Peru, Mexico, and 24 more countries.

Bazan Pronunciation Guide

ARPAbet Phonetic Pronunciation: B EY Z AH N

B: Pronounce as in "big" (B IH G)

EY: Pronounce as in "they" (DH EY)

Z: Pronounce as in "zoo" (Z UW)

AH: Pronounce as in "but" (B AH T)

N: Pronounce as in "no" (N OW)

This pronunciation guide uses the ARPABET system, a phonetic notation developed by the Advanced Research Projects Agency (ARPA) for speech recognition systems. Each ARPABET symbol corresponds to a distinct sound in English. For example, 'JH' represents the sound as in 'joke,' 'AA' represents the sound as in 'father,' and 'N' represents the sound as in 'no.'

The pronunciation guide was generated using the CMU Pronouncing Dictionary, a public domain resource for phonetic pronunciations of words.
